Venture capital deals

Anaplan, a Redwood City, Calif.-based provider of modeling and planning solutions for finance and operations, has raised $30 million in new VC funding. Meritech Capital Partners led the round, and was joined by return backers Granite Ventures and Shasta Ventures. www.anaplan.com

Hybris Software, a German commerce platform provider, has raised $30 million in new equity funding.Meritech Capital Partners and Greylock Israel were joined by existing backer Huntsman Gay Global Capital. www.hybris.com

PeopleMatter, a Charleston, S.C.-based provider of HR management software for hourly workforces, has raised $19 million in new VC funding. Scale Venture Partners led the round, and was joined by return backers Intersouth Partners, Morgenthaler Ventures, Harbert Venture Partners, Noro-Moseley Partners, C&B Capital and Silicon Valley Bank. www.peoplematter.com

FindTheBest, a Santa Barbara, Calif.-based comparison commerce platform, has raised $11 million in Series B funding. New World Ventures led the round, and was joined by Montgomery & Co. and return backer Kleiner Perkins Caufield & Byers. www.findthebest.com

Retailigence, a Redwood City, Calif.-based hyper-local marketing and commerce platform, has raised $6.3 million in new VC funding. No investor information was disclosed, but existing backers include Draper Fisher Jurvetson, 500 Startups, EchoVC Partners, Motorola Solutions Venture Capital, OPT Inc., Quest Venture Partners and ZIG Capital. www.retailigence.com

Sophia Search, a San Jose, Calif.–based provider of semantic content analysis, has raised $3.7 million in Series A funding led by Atlantic Bridge. www.sophiasearch.com

Epoxy Inc., a Los Angeles-based provider of tools for professional video channels and networks, has raised $2 million in VC funding led by GRP Partners. www.epoxy.tv

Lucid Energy, a Portland, Ore.-based provider of renewable energy systems, has raised an undisclosed amount of funding from Israeli VC/crowdfunding platform OurCrowd. www.lucidenergy.com
